Describe briefly the term speciation?
Expert
Speciation is the procedure by which dissimilar species emerge from a common ancestor species. Speciation usually begins when populations of similar species become geographically isolated, that is, when they are separated by the some physical barrier that prohibits crossing between individuals from one population and individuals of any other population.
Groups that for a extensive time are kept under geographical isolation tend to accumulate different phenotypical characteristics from each other by means of genetic variability (mutations and recombination) and natural selection. When those differences reach a point that makes the crossing of individuals of one group with individuals of the other group impossible or the generation of fertile offspring no longer happens it is said that speciation has occurred.
